At the end of my post on JRuby and JDK 25 startup time features, I teased a bit of the unreleased improvements from Project Leyden. It turns out the latest commits improve startup time even more, so it seems worth posting a quick follow-up!
Project Leyden is LIT
Of the many OpenJDK projects I follow, Leyden has been near the top as far as activity and interest. In the past month, there’s been 527 commits to all branches… over 15 commits per day. And this doesn’t include commits being done by contributors on their own repositories. It’s exciting to watch!
